Videotec signs up with DVS

One of the UK’s fastest growing distributors of security and CCTV equipment, DVS, has entered into a distribution agreement with Videotec, the leading manufacturer of professional CCTV products for outdoor applications.

DVS’ Managing Director, Shaun Bowie, said the Italian company’s products were the perfect addition to DVS’s portfolio of CCTV equipment.

“Videotec is renowned as the world leader in high quality, high technology surveillance camera positioning units, housings, LED lighting equipment and CCTV accessories,” he said. “Their design-led sensibility means that not only are Videotec’s products highly functional and effective, they’re also attractive on an aesthetic level – which leads to increased end-user interest and more project work for installers and integrators.”

DVS will stock all of Videotec’s standard housings, LED lighting range and accessories as well as supplying Videotec’s Ulisse positioning units, the only range of pan and tilt units in the world able to be driven by ONVIF IP protocols, carry an IP Camera (HD or Megapixel) with a large lens, and maintain 360 degree rotation whilst carrying LED IR Lights.

In addition, DVS will stock all of Videotec’s specialist housing range, which includes marine housings and housing systems/PTZs for use in the oil and gas industries.

Videotec’s Regional Country Manager Bob Groom said: “I am incredibly happy to be working with DVS. Their dedication to providing solutions to the CCTV industry and being at the forefront of technology mirrors the ethos within Videotec. Both Videotec and DVS are well placed to support customers with the changes from analogue to IP solutions. Working closely together, this partnership will enable us to meet our customers’ needs more quickly and efficiently.”
